How Much Does a Conference Room in Hawaii Cost?
The costs of conference rooms in Hawaii can vary based on the type of venue and services required. Typical day-delegate rates range between $75 to $150 per person, depending on the inclusions such as catering and AV services. Half-day hires are often available, with prices around $50 to $100 per person. Full-day hires tend to range from $500 to $5000 based on capacities and facilities. Accessibility & Transport in Hawaii
Hawaii is easily accessible for corporate delegates traveling for conferences, with the main airport, Daniel K. Inouye International Airport (HNL), connecting to numerous major cities. Public transport options are available, including shuttle services and express buses. Road access is convenient for those who prefer to drive, and car rentals are readily available.
